Problem
Existing methods for generating carpet boundary images for ground sweeping robots result in rough images, hindering effective cleaning and positioning.
Innovation Solution
A map drawing method that scans the carpet boundary, merges initial boundary coordinates, divides the region into sub-regions based on a preset shape, and draws the boundary for a smooth, detailed map, enhancing cleaning and positioning accuracy.

If existing boundary scanning methods are used to generate carpet boundary images, then the scanning process is simple and fast, but the obtained boundary image is rough and lacks detail
Solution Approach 1:
The patent divides the merged region into multiple sub-regions based on preset shapes (rectangles, circles, triangles, etc.). Each sub-region is processed independently to generate boundary coordinates, which are then merged to form the final boundary image. This segmentation approach improves boundary image quality by allowing detailed processing of each sub-region while managing complexity through systematic division of the overall process.

Provided are a map drawing method, a map drawing device, a computer-readable storage medium and an electronic apparatus. The map drawing method comprises scanning a boundary of a surface medium region to generate an initialized region; merging boundary coordinates of the initialized region to obtain a merged region; dividing the merged region into a plurality of sub-regions according to a preset shape; and drawing the boundary of the surface medium region based on the sub-regions and the merged region to obtain a map of the surface medium region. The method can improve the detailedness of the drawn map of the surface medium region.
